How is the International OrthoBioMsk SUBA Course?

 The course section dedicated to Orthobiology will be on Thursday, February 17, where we will explain the basic sciences, regulation, types of biological therapies (PRP, BMAC, microfragmented adipose tissue, etc.), and above all, practical cases with documented methodology and precise technique. The Ultrasound-Msk section would be 2 days, Friday 18 and Saturday 19 February, focusing on sonoanatomy and the essential ultrasound-guided intervention techniques in daily clinical practice. Topics include the shoulder, elbow, wrist/hand, hip, knee, foot/ankle anatomy, and spine.

The techniques ultrasound-guided Therapies (UGT) are shown in depth through video-clinical techniques and practical sessions «hands-on,» where there will be 1 team and model for every 4 participants.

All carefully selected teachers have advanced certifications in MSK Ultrasound and Ortobiology and will supervise students based on 3 levels of training, making the practice appropriate for all levels of experience.

Likewise, given the variety of suppliers and stands for Ultrasound-Msk and Regenerative Medicine, attendees will be able to see and take advantage of «special offers» to buy the latest models in the industry in both desktops, portable, hand-held, wired, and wireless ultrasounds or systems of Biological Therapies or Shock Waves.

Thursday’s Orthobiology Seminar is a fundamental and clinical science update on current best practices for using PRP, stem cells, and other Biological Therapies of the Locomotor System.

Course objectives:

By the end of this course, each participant should be better able to:

– Understand the current indications for orthobiological products based on published evidence

– Understand the main indications and techniques for ultrasound-guided PRP / stem cell infiltrations

– Understand how to maximize cell counts in both peripheral blood and bone marrow aspiration during office procedures

– Understand the operation of musculoskeletal ultrasound machines

– List the indications for musculoskeletal ultrasound

– Understand the role of ultrasound MSK in clinical practice

– Recognize normal and pathological ultrasound anatomy of the shoulder, elbow, hip, knee, foot/ankle, and spine

– Use techniques guided by ultrasound for Ultrasound-Guided Therapies (TEG) MSK and nerve blocks.
